Company Overview

Established in the 1930s as a trading business, Al-Futtaim Group today is one of the most diversified and progressive, privately held regional businesses headquartered in Dubai, United Arab Emirates. Structured into five operating divisions: automotive, financial services, real estate, retail, and healthcare; employing more than 35,000 employees across more than 20 countries in the Middle East, Asia, and Africa, Al-Futtaim Group partners with over 200 of the world's most admired and innovative brands. Al-Futtaim Group’s entrepreneurship and relentless customer focus enables the organisation to continue to grow and expand; responding to the changing needs of our customers within the societies in which we operate.

By upholding our values of respect, excellence, collaboration, and integrity; Al-Futtaim Group continues to enrich the lives and aspirations of our customers each and every day.

Overview of the role

The Junior HRBP position is responsible for extending strategic and operational HR support for Al Futtaim Contracting Division in Qatar. The HRBP collaborates closely with operations and employees to foster a high-performance culture, enhance capabilities, and ensure compliance with HR policies and procedures.

What you will do

  • Align with operations and business heads to understand business goals and priorities and provide HR guidance to support business strategy.
  • Play an active role in assessing manpower requirements, prepare and review manpower budgets and forecasts.
  • Ensure annual manpower budgeting exercise is conducted accurately and efficiently in collaboration with Senior HRBP.
  • Liaise with the hiring manager and talent acquisition partner for job briefing, explaining and clarifying the requirements of the role.
  • Support the line manager in creating job requisitions on People Hub (SAP), reviewing job descriptions.
  • Play an active role in the interview and selection of candidates, providing balanced and unbiased feedback to the interview panel.
  • Ensure that offer letters are issued to candidates in alignment with the Qatar compensation structure and Al Futtaim SOPs.
  • Ensure seamless onboarding experience for new employees, arranging induction plans and managing communication, keeping all stakeholders informed, and preparing joining announcements.
  • Monitor the weekly onboarding tracker shared by People Services team to ensure that the data pertaining to Al Futtaim Contracting is accurate.
  • Manage probation process, including booking probation meetings over the course of the first six months, ensuring goals are aligned with line managers.
  • Ensure that employees across all levels of hierarchy are informed of relevant HR policies, benefits, and any changes thereof.
  • Provide resolutions and answers to queries raised by employees.
  • Ensure that talent management activities including talent review and identification of critical roles are managed as per internal process.
  • Arrange the annual employee engagement and wellbeing calendar including all team building, annual conferences, sport, and wellbeing events for camp employees. Manage Eid and other key celebrations as directed in line with AFRE direction.
  • Ensure that employee engagement surveys and growing together surveys are communicated and ensure all relevant population participation.
  • Ensure optimum utilization of the reward and recognition platform through timely communication and ownership by line managers. Ensure nominations for both blue- and white-collar workforce.
  • Liaise with business and provide the training need analysis for each division to the L&D partner.
  • Ensure that generic training programs organized by Real Estate L&D team and Group HR are well represented with participation and nomination from AF Contracting, Qatar.
  • Provide timely inputs to the Senior HRBP, Head of HR, Data Analytics team, and TR team for effecting salary increments and promotions.
  • Ensure that all employee relations cases are dealt with confidentiality, speed, objectivity, and following principles of natural justice.
  • Organize meetings, interviews, prepare statements and records, share with the Group ER, and close out as per guidance.
  • Ensure that contracts pertaining to office, staff accommodation, food contract, laundry contract, etc. are active and renewed in a timely manner.
  • Ensure that outsourced vendors’ contracts are renewed in a timely manner.
  • Verify and share overtime and leave inputs for payroll with the People Services team after approvals from Operations Manager and Senior HRBP.

Required skills to be successful

  • Strong communication and interpersonal skills.
  • Problem-solving ability, negotiation, and influencing skills.
  • Time management and ability to manage multiple priorities.
  • Mentoring and coaching skills, employee relations.
  • Ability to maintain confidentiality while dealing with sensitive matters.

What equips you for the role

  • Bachelor’s degree in administration or HR.
  • Minimum of 5 years of experience in HR function at a large-sized company, managed blue collar employees, with supervisory skills essential to perform the job effectively.
  • Excellent knowledge in the use of the Microsoft suite such as Excel, Word, PowerPoint, etc.

About the Company

Established in the 1930's, the Al-Futtaim Group initially operated as a trading enterprise. Rapid development throughout the 1940's and 50's saw it establish itself regionally as an integrated commercial, industrial and services organisation, positioning itself one of the leading business houses in the lower Gulf region. Today, it operates collectively over 40 companies bearing the Al-Futtaim name, dominates many market segments in the UAE, and has expanded its sphere of operation to include Bahrain, Kuwait, Qatar, Oman and Egypt.

The Group comprises a diverse range of strategically positioned operating subsidiaries and associate companies, structured to give the Al-Futtaim Group the flexibility and versatility to keep ahead of local competition while keeping pace with the ever-evolving global business scenario. The Groups continued investment in world-class systems technology is clear evidence of its commitment to maintain leading edge performance and service delivery.

The success of the Al-Futtaim Group can be attributed to a business approach that combines the ability to change with the traditional values of integrity, service and social responsibility that define its core business philosophy. This, linked with the Groups belief in decentralisation, gives the heads of the operating companies a high degree of functional autonomy and authority, providing the Group with essential flexibility, and individual employees a clearly defined work culture and sense of responsibility.
